Transaction 88d31724aa3a677c84c568f486a6b530331ff6354ed0f1821225a7b5e59f3827
1 Input
1 Output
-
88d31724aa3a677c84c568f486a6b530331ff6354ed0f1821225a7b5e59f3827:0
- value
- 667716
- script pubkey
- OP_0 OP_PUSHBYTES_20 6897286f66abe7d590eaef1132772827c37658be
- address
- bc1qdztjsmmx40naty82augnyaegylphvk97swq9vm